Victory Through Air Power (1943)
Based on the book by Major Alexander de Seversky's about his theories of the practical uses of long range strategic bombing. Using a combination of animation humorously telling about the development of air warfare, the film shows de Seversky illustrating his ideas of how air power could win World War II for the Allies.
Directors: James Algar, Clyde Geronimi, Jack Kinney, H. C. Potter.
